McDonald’s has always been at the top of Technomic’s Top 500 Chain Restaurant Report, and remains far bigger than any other U.S. restaurant chain.

Could that change anytime soon?

In this week’s episode of Restaurant Business’ podcast, “A Deeper Dive,” we spoke with Joe Pawlak, managing principal with RB sister company Technomic, to talk about whether Starbucks or Chick-fil-A could one day topple the Chicago-based giant.

We also spoke about what the future of the Top 500 could look like, including what other industry segments could make real noise in the coming years. The conversation featured talk about chicken concepts, fast-casual pizza, Five Guys and Chipotle.
